The world population is growing fast. Cities are inflating and sites became expensive and small creating problems such as privacy. Design a house in a small site became a challenge and more often we see new houses design looking like a castle. The house now closes itself and the external walls now act like a fence wall. The project bellow is an example (in a big proportion) of what is possible to do to keep the privacy when is design a house. The same example can be used for sites located on busy roads as it is possible to close the house to the noise side and open it internally. The shatoko house has used the swimming pool and the ponds to decorate and entertain the ambient but also with an area to cool the air and help to keep the house cooled. Architects: Shatotto
Location: Dhaka, Bangladesh
Project Year: 2011
Project Area: 20,667 sq ft
Photographs: Daniele Domenicali

In the current trend of real estate development, this residence has been a challenge particularly placing a water court as swimming pool in the middle of the house, a surely difficult task to ensure privacy. As a result, an introverted design has been adopted.
The south and the southeast have been designed to bring in cool breeze during the hot humid summer and the warmth of the sun during winter. The center “water court” acts as a natural exhaust, which flows out the hot air and makes the middle court a solace. http://www.shatotto.com/shatotto-details.html?id=19
